Transaction 123f049e7546301c579665ffcc84b2068a0bf8bbb826d6b493d3e0ac81aeaabb

1 Input
2 Outputs
  • 123f049e7546301c579665ffcc84b2068a0bf8bbb826d6b493d3e0ac81aeaabb:0
  • value  9620785
    address  3E5mAxq3dZGTKmkaH3TTC7j2yWSTji8452
  • 123f049e7546301c579665ffcc84b2068a0bf8bbb826d6b493d3e0ac81aeaabb:1
  • value  314939
    address  3G1Ybuaf7N2oJ7Dpou5xAdTMvzQ9QmVgdN